What does a Product Manager at Swire Coca-Cola do?
As a Product Manager in our IT organization, you will act as a strategic liaison between Technology and business units, supporting the advancement of organizational goals through effective product management. You will align technology capabilities with business needs, manage the full product lifecycle, and foster collaboration across teams and stakeholders. This role is ideal for a results-driven professional with strong leadership skills and a proven track record in technology management, ready to drive impactful product initiatives in a dynamic IT environment.

Responsibilities:



  • Align technology capabilities and product initiatives with business unit objectives, identifying opportunities for innovation and technical improvements that deliver value to stakeholders and users.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with business unit managers and internal stakeholders, collaborating to understand needs, gather requirements, and support strategic IT planning.
  • Oversee the end-to-end lifecycle of IT products, from ideation and planning through launch, assessment, and iteration, ensuring products meet business goals and user expectations.
  • Lead product design and implementation, applying product management principles to coordinate cross-functional teams and ensure timely completion of product milestones.
  • Implement agile methodologies, manage sprints, drive continuous improvement through iterative solutions, and facilitate agile ceremonies to enhance team performance.
  • Leverage emerging technology trends and conduct market analysis to propose enhancements that maximize business impact and user satisfaction.
  • Manage product documentation to ensure accuracy, accessibility, and support for users and enablement initiatives.
  • Collaborate with internal teams, vendors, and suppliers to coordinate efforts, resolve issues, and deliver high-quality outcomes aligned with business needs.
  • Track and optimize key performance indicators (KPIs) such as business value delivery (e.g., revenue, customer lifetime value, churn), user adoption rates, customer satisfaction, on-time delivery, return on investment, product strategy alignment, intake-to-solution time, time-to-market, team engagement scores, career progression tracking, documentation discoverability, and cross-functional collaboration.


Requirements:



  • Bachelor's Degree Engineering, Information Technology, Business Management, or a related field required
  • Master's Degree or MBA a plus
  • 4+ years in product management or technology management roles, with a demonstrated history of leading initiatives, products, or services that drive organizational technology evolution, preferably supporting business units or operations functions required
  • Product lifecycle management and market analysis
  • Proficiency in agile methodologies and product management
  • Strong analytical skills for data-driven decision-making and KPI tracking
